Metal cladding repair services involve assessing and restoring metal exterior panels on buildings to ensure structural integrity and aesthetic appeal. These services typically include identifying areas of damage such as corrosion, dents, or cracks, and then performing necessary repairs to restore the panels to their original condition. Repair professionals may remove damaged sections, treat rust or corrosion, and replace or reinforce panels as needed.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the metal cladding while maintaining the property's appearance and functionality.
Addressing common problems like corrosion, warping, or physical damage, metal cladding repair helps prevent further deterioration that could compromise the building’s exterior.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ause metal panels to weaken, develop leaks, or lose their visual appeal. Repair services aim to mitigate these issues by restoring the panels’ protective qualities and structural soundness, thereby reducing the risk of more extensive and costly repairs in the future. Properly maintained metal cladding can also improve energy efficiency and protect the interior of the property from moisture intrusion.

The overview below groups typical Metal Cladding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oakville,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material and Scope - Costs for metal cladding repair vary based on the type of metal and the extent of damage. Typically, repairs can range from $1,000 to $5,000 for small to moderate issues. Larger projects or complex repairs may exceed this range.
Labor and Service Fees - Labor costs for metal cladding rep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, depending on local rates and project complexity. Total costs depend on the number of panels or sections needing work.
Material Replacement - Replacing damaged panels or sections of metal cladding can cost between $20 and $50 per square foot. Prices vary based on material quality and custom fabrication requirements.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face preparation, paint or coating applications, and disposal of old materials. These additional services can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the overall cost.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
